GEM America, Inc. uses Graveson Energy Management Thermal
Cracking Technology (TCT) to convert common commercial and municipal waste
into clean synthetic gas. TCT, a proven technology, is currently used by
the petrochemical industry to crack heavy crude oil into a more easily refined
lighter crude. GEM America takes TCT to the next level.
GEM has revolutionized the TCT process to convert
common wastes into clean synthetic gas without combustion.
(Convertable waste include organic solids, municipal solid waste (MSW),
commercial waste, sludge, wood, agricultural waste, used oil, rubber tires, and
non-recyclable plastics). GEM America's TCT process allows municipalities,
industries and waste collectors to achieve landfill reduction targets and
increase recycling revenues and produce electricity. The clean synthetic gas
produced by GEM can be used to heat boilers (by replacing natural gas or mixing
with natural gas), put through reciprocating engines to produce electricity or
converted into methanol.

GEM’s advanced thermal conversion process can be described as ‘flash
pyrolysis’. It is the chemical decomposition of feedstock by intensive heat in
the absence of oxygen atmosphere also known as “destructive distillation” or
“cracking”. This well established process has been utilised commercially for
many years, it is widely used in the petro-chemical industry.
GEM recognised the superior efficiency of this thermal process and
have applied its principles to the waste management and renewable energy
markets. The advantages of this process are:-
> Identifies wasted
resources as valuable fuel.
> Utilises that fuel
by efficiently converting it into synthetic gas.
> Synthetic gas
produced is a replacement for natural gas, reducing reliance on fossil fuel
energy sources.
> Generates
renewable electricity and heat from that synthetic gas.
> Enables landfill
diversion without discouraging recycling,
> Improves the
environmental impact compared with traditional forms of waste disposal and
power generation.
